Preconstruction Manager – Multi-Family (Reno, NV)
Salary: $100,000–$125,000
Our client is seeking a Preconstruction Manager to lead multi-family pursuits across the Reno market. This is an opportunity for a proven professional who understands the pace, relationships, and complexity of multi-family development and thrives on shaping projects before construction begins.
Role Overview
The Preconstruction Manager will lead front-end strategy for multi-family projects, partnering closely with developers, architects, and trade partners. This role is responsible for driving budgeting, procurement strategy, and design-phase decision-making to deliver competitive, executable project plans.
This individual will serve as the primary client-facing representative during pre-construction while ensuring a seamless transition to operations. The role also plays a critical part in aligning project scope, mitigating risk, and supporting subcontractor contract execution to minimize change orders and scope gaps.

Key Responsibilities
- Lead all pre-construction efforts for multi-family developments (wrap, podium, garden-style)
- Serve as a trusted advisor to developers, ownership groups, and design teams
- Develop conceptual and detailed construction budgets based on current market conditions
- Drive value engineering and cost optimization without compromising design intent
- Build and execute procurement strategies leveraging strong subcontractor relationships
- Identify risks early and provide proactive, solution-oriented recommendations
- Collaborate with operations teams to ensure seamless project turnover
- Support client development efforts and contribute to repeat business strategies
- Lead, mentor, and manage estimating team members
- Oversee estimating resources, buyout processes, and pre-construction workflows
- Assist in subcontractor contract alignment to ensure scope accuracy and cost control
